What Challenges Does the Tungsten Carbide Industry Face in 2026?
Global tungsten ore prices have surged 20-30% year-over-year due to supply constraints in key mining regions and rising energy costs, driving up production expenses for carbide tools and wear parts. Demand from electric vehicles, aerospace, and defense sectors competes directly with industrial needs, creating shortages that delay projects by weeks. Manufacturers report 15-25% higher raw material costs, squeezing margins amid stricter environmental regulations on emissions and ethical sourcing.
In mining alone, equipment downtime from wear reaches 20% of operating time, costing the industry $5 billion annually in lost productivity. Construction firms face similar issues, with drill bits and blades failing 3-5x faster under abrasive conditions, inflating replacement budgets by 40%. These pressures amplify as global infrastructure spending hits $9 trillion by 2027, demanding more durable solutions.
Why Do Traditional Solutions Fall Short for Tungsten Carbide Needs?
High-speed steel tools offer baseline performance but wear out 10-20x faster than carbide, requiring frequent changes that disrupt workflows and raise labor costs by 30%. Standard carbide grades from legacy suppliers suffer from inconsistent porosity and lower densities below 14.5 g/cm³, leading to premature failure under high-stress loads over 4000 MPa.
Many providers lack full-chain control, relying on outsourced sintering that introduces defects at rates above 1%, compared to under 0.5% for integrated producers. Recycling processes for carbide remain complex and yield only 95% recovery, while substitutes like ceramics lack the toughness for interrupted cuts or erosive slurries.

What Is the Step-by-Step Process to Adopt These Solutions?
-
Assess operating conditions: Identify abrasion levels, temperatures, and loads (e.g., YG8 for mining impacts).
-
Select grade: Match cobalt % (6% finishing, 20% shock resistance) via supplier tools.
-
Request samples: Start with MOQ of 10 pcs for testing.
-
Test in field: Measure penetration rates and wear over 1,000 hours.
-
Scale OEM order: Integrate brazing/welding for full assemblies, targeting 100+ pcs.
-
Monitor ROI: Track downtime cuts and cost savings quarterly.
